4 Fig 3 Kaplan-Meier curve for the time to first asthma exacerbation during the overall randomized treatment period. The estimated probability of having an asthma exacerbation at each time point is shown. Data symbols represent the days on which censored observations occurred. Hazard ratios (95% CIs) for treatment comparisons are as follows: adjustable-dose budesonide/formoterol pMDI versus fixed-dose fluticasone propionate/salmeterol DPI (0.847 [95% CI, 0.526–1.366; P = .496]), fixed-dose budesonide/formoterol pMDI versus adjustable-dose budesonide/formoterol (1.163 [95% CI, 0.722–1.875; P = .535]), and fixed-dose budesonide/formoterol pMDI versus fixed-dose fluticasone propionate/salmeterol (0.994 [95% CI, 0.791–1.248; P = .958]). AD, Adjustable dose; BUD, budesonide; FM, formoterol; FD, fixed dose; FP, fluticasone propionate; SM, salmeterol.
